How low cost dental plans differ from standard insurance:
Instant Savings: Once you are on a membership plan, you receive a 10% to 60% off. You pay the dentist instantly for their services, and there are no hidden fees.
For example, you need a procedure that typically costs $300. As a part of the discount plan, you are qualified to receive a 60% discount on this treatment.
As a result, you will just fork out $ 120 to have your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No other service fees will be applied. This subsidized rate enables you to immediately get affordable dental care.
No paperwork troubles: With standard insurance plan, there is a long waiting period that you must undergo while the insurance agency determines whether or not you qualify for insurance coverage. This is referred to as the underwriting period.
There is no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your regular membership becomes active within three days from the moment you become a member of the discount network. If you choose an insurance for your family, they will be insured at the same time as you.
No monthly premiums: There are no monthly payments to pay. Once you have enrolled in your discount plan, you’ll be covered for a all year round.
No deductions: There is no de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. When you are a member of the network, you’re completely qualified to receive member savings. The dental professionals provide their dental services to members at a drastically lower rate.
All dentists in the dental network are certified by the board in their area of specialty. Membership coverage incorporates emergency treatments and preventative including cleanings, root canals, fillings, bridges, crowns, orthodontics, extractions, X-rays and a lot more. Here are helpful tips for lowering the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.
Avoid frequent X-rays: Your dentist may suggest a dental x-ray on your first visit, a scheduled check-up, or a return for medication.
However the American Dental Association (ADA) suggests that the frequency of trips to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the current state of the patient’s dental health.
Thus, if you have good dental health, you simply don’t need tooth x-rays at every appointment to the dentist.
If you take an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can not only save a lot of money, but it will also prevent you from being in contact with possibly damaging X-rays.
Use negotiation: One other way to minimize the cost of your dental treatment is to consult with your dental professional with regards to payment methods during the first consultation.
After getting a clear idea of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s bill, you can claim a discount on the dental charge.
Your health care provider and dental center can offer you various payment choices. Do not be hesitant to pay for your dental bills monthly or quarterly.
Exchange: It may appear crazy, but you can get hold of free dentistry through the barter system. Patients with different professional skills and services, such as carpentry or website development, can modify their dental care services.
For example, you can develop a website for your dental professional or offer plumbing, mechanics or other service in return for the cost of dental treatment.
Looking for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To boost the size of your dental savings, take into consideration getting your dental care at a dental institution, where dental treatments will be performed by students under the supervision of certified dentists at a portion of what you would pay in the medical clinic of a private dental professional.
Brush and floss regularly: More significantly, if you’d like to spend less, you need to take good care of your oral health.
Remember to brush your teeth twice daily or after mealtime and floss at least once a day to prevent the risk of oral issues. Reduce your sugar intake to reduce your dental problems.

Floss and brush
Healthy and clean teeth are the beginning of dental health. Frequent use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is essential to keep your gums and teeth healthy and healthy. Brush te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ps prevent teeth cavities.
Do not be in a hurry. Instead, take the time to brush teeth. Be sure to use a brush that fits the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.
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Additionally, clean the tongue to avoid smelly breath and make certain to replace your toothbrush every two months.
Daily dental flossing is also necessary. Flossing helps you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and underneath the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th carefully with floss and do not skimp.
If you have trouble flossing between your teeth, try using waxed dental floss. Be as cautious as you can when flossing to prevent harming your gums. Additionally, consider providing d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.
Watch your diet
Avoid sugary goodies because too much-refined sugar increases the growth of the plaque. Be sure you drink and feed on healthy foods, like low-fat dairy foods, whole wheat, and green veggies.
Get plenty of fluids to stay hydrated. Avoid soft dr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m your teeth.
Don’t use cigarettes and tobacco products as they result in gum illness and oral cancer. It must be taken into account that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as necessary as flossing and brushing your teeth.
